From c51096e17eb6d2d628d17ef0f01afd84ffc25ffa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?P=C4=93teris=20Caune?= <cuu508@gmail.com>
Date: Thu, 14 Nov 2024 14:50:35 +0200
Subject: [PATCH] Fix dropdown button background in dark mode

---
 static/css/bootstrap-colors.css | 11 +++++++----
 static/css/checks.css           |  2 +-
 2 files changed, 8 insertions(+), 5 deletions(-)

diff --git a/static/css/bootstrap-colors.css b/static/css/bootstrap-colors.css
index 89806164..7a5ac763 100644
--- a/static/css/bootstrap-colors.css
+++ b/static/css/bootstrap-colors.css
@@ -11,7 +11,10 @@
 .btn-default:active,
 .btn-default:active:focus,
 .btn-default.active.focus,
-.btn-default.active:hover {
+.btn-default.active:hover,
+.open > .dropdown-toggle.btn-default,
+.open > .dropdown-toggle.btn-default:hover,
+.open > .dropdown-toggle.btn-default:focus {
     color: var(--btn-active-color);
     background-color: var(--btn-active-bg);
     border-color: var(--btn-active-border);
@@ -45,9 +48,9 @@
 }
 
 .text-success {
-    color:  var(--text-success);
+    color: var(--text-success);
 }
 
 .text-danger {
-    color:  var(--text-danger);
-}
\ No newline at end of file
+    color: var(--text-danger);
+}
diff --git a/static/css/checks.css b/static/css/checks.css
index 2f4dfb55..72dc12c9 100644
--- a/static/css/checks.css
+++ b/static/css/checks.css
@@ -45,7 +45,7 @@
     padding-left: 30px;
 }
 
-#filters > button {
+#filters > button:not(:active) {
     box-shadow: none;
 }